Durability

A sofa that is durable can last for years to come particularly if the fabric is resistant to wear and tear. Select fabrics that are easy to clean, and select an anti-stain option if you have kids or pets. You can also purchase sofa covers which are easy to clean and can give a fresh look.

The size of your room will determine what sectional sofa you choose, and how you arrange it. Larger pieces can accommodate more people, making them perfect for those who want to gather with friends and family. Some pieces feature recliners at both ends. This provides additional comfort for those who want to watch movies at home.

Avoid pinch-points when you arrange your sectional. These are areas in the space where the sectional is close to other furniture. Having too much space between the sofa and the wall or between the couch and a different piece of furniture can make it difficult to move in and out of the sectional.

Maintenance

The fabric type and construction determine the durability of a sectional couch as well as its maintenance needs. The best option is an extremely solid and well-built frame that is able to support the entire weight of the cushions, and an upholstery of top quality. These factors will make the sofa comfortable to sit on for long durations and resistant to sagging and tearing. Fabrics should be stain-resistant particularly if the sofa is going to be used by pets or children.

Regular vacuuming using an upholstery attachment can keep l shaped couch sectional looking and smell fresh. Be aware of crevices and corners, as well as underneath cushions. A spray cleaner that is specific to the sofa's material can be applied to the stains that occur. Test the cleaner on a small portion before applying it to the entire surface. Avoid placing the sectional in areas that will be exposed to intense sunlight for long periods of time. This could cause the furniture to weaken and fade.

During regular cleaning make use of an old bristle or toothbrush to brush off loose hair and lint from the sectional. These particles can cause fabrics of the furniture to degrade quickly since they are attracted to them. This should be done once a week in order to stop the particles from building up.
